The document details how Jeffrey Epstein coordinated and documented financial transactions involving Leon Black and Inna Siroochenko between 2011 and 2017, including at least $2.5 million in payments classified as gifts, art purchases through Siroochenko’s firm, and a proposed $1.8 million commission tied to a Paul Klee sale. It highlights accountants’ concerns over conflicts of interest and the handling of funds related to a property purchase in Lviv, Ukraine, while noting the records do not establish illegality or confirm whether certain transactions were completed. The materials contribute to the broader public record of Epstein’s role in complex financial arrangements intersecting personal payments, business dealings, and tax planning.
